My cousin was getting married and she wanted to get both sides of the family together at the dinner table. Their apartment was a little too small to accommodate everybody so we walked down the street to Zazie for a lovely evening.

The menu was prix fixe and we started off the evening with some red and white wine, and sparkling lemonade, along with some fresh rolls. The appetizers consisted of pate on bread with salad and steamed mussels in a white wine sauce. The pate was great of course and the white wine sauce was awesome with the mussels. I ordered the chicken with fresh fettuccine and bacon sauce. The chicken was unbelievably tender and fell of the bone. However, the rest of the dish was a little bland to be honest. I opted for the peach cobbler for dessert with fresh cream which was incredible and was my favorite course.

Service was pretty good and we always had plenty of wine, perhaps too much. The company was amazing and it was a fun evening for all. The back patio is lovely in the evening and I'm excited to go back to try their regular menu with my girlfriend sometime. They've even got a few dog-friendly seats outside when the weather is nice and your pup is in tow. Definitely worth checking out!
